‘30-Rock’ Alum Sue Galloway, Hip-Hop Improv by North Coast & More Highlight 5th Annual SteelStacks Improv Comedy Festival



 

More than 50 improv acts from across U.S. to perform Jan. 26-27 at ArtsQuest Center; tickets for festival go on sale today

BETHLEHEM, PA—Hip-Hop improv troupe North Coast and The Law Firm, with Sue Galloway of “30 Rock,” headline the 5th Annual SteelStacks Improv Comedy Festival Jan. 26-27 at the ArtsQuest Center at SteelStacks, 101 Founders Way, Bethlehem. The festival will also feature an improvised action movie, an interactive one-man show, puppets, a live comic book creation and teams from the acclaimed UCB Theatre (UCB) in New York, as well as 50 other improv comedy groups from across the U.S. Hours are 6 p.m.-12 a.m. Friday and 11 a.m.-2 a.m. Saturday.

On Jan. 26, 9:35 p.m., SteelStacks welcomes The Law Firm featuring “30 Rock” alum and “SNL” freelance writer Sue Galloway, whose recent appearances include “Sisters” alongside Tina Fey and Amy Poehler and HBO’s “Girls.” Asking the audience if they’ve been wronged by a bad boss, flaky friend or an identity stealing ex-love, The Law Firm turns one audience member’s testimony into a fully improvised show. Members of The Law Firm, which performs weekly at the UCB Theatre in Hell’s Kitchen, have starred in and written for “Broad City,” “Best Week Ever,” “Late Night with Seth Meyers” and more.

Catch the mind-blowing stylings of hip-hop improv group North Coast Jan. 27, 9:30 p.m. With a cast of improv comedy veterans from UCB, the Peoples Improv Theater and The Magnet theaters in New York City, North Coast’s explosive performances have been packing comedy venues, universities and festivals nationwide since 2009. Built around a single suggestion from an audience member, the show’s improvised scenes escalate into full-blown hip-hop songs, facilitated by renowned beatboxers Ethan “Exacto” Scott and Kaila Mullady. Named one of the “Top Ten Best Comedy Shows” by Time Out New York, North Coast has been featured in Slate’s Podcast “The Gist,” The Village Voice and The New York Times Comedy Listings.

In addition to the headlining performances, the improv festival will showcase improv groups from New York City, Philadelphia, Washington D.C., Baltimore and San Francisco, as well as teams from throughout the Lehigh Valley. Among the many highlights are an interactive one-man show by Bird & Friends; an improvised satire of Spanish language video tutorials by Los Profesores; an improvised action movie by Bronson; a handheld puppet performance by Team Lopez; and an improvised origin story of a superhero in “Crisis: An Improvised Comic Book.”
